Minimally Invasive Surgical Approach to Decompress a Multi-Loculated Abscess in the Thoracic Spine: A Case Report

Tuberculosis (TB) remains one of the major global causes death; Mycobacterium it. Approximately 10% patients with TB may develop extrapulmonary bone tuberculosis, spine being most affected, representing 1 to 2% all cases. Pott disease is a form TB, and recently it has shown significant resurgence in developed nations possibly impacted by migration. often misdiagnosed or sometimes diagnosed during its late stages, which can be associated devastating consequences patient. Brazil among top 20 countries high burden tuberculosis; however, published evidence still limited, particularly last two years COVID-19 pandemic. Under this context, we present clinical case 43 old female patient minimally invasive surgical approach decompress multi-loculated abscess thoracic spine.

متن کاملMinimally Invasive Lateral Approach to the Thoracic Spine – Case Report and Literature Overview
Background context: Alternatives to access the anterior portion of the thoracic spine include thoracotomy, thoracoscopy, and transpedicular approaches. These techniques have proven to be either extremely traumatic or to be technically difficult. Consequently, these approaches are not routinely used.
